Overview

Discover the rich, complex, and true story behind one of the world's most misunderstood spiritual traditions. From its ancient African roots through the transatlantic slave trade to its vibrant expressions across the Caribbean and Americas, this book offers a 100% factual, deeply researched exploration of Voodoo's origins, beliefs, rituals, and cultural impact. Explore the distinctions between Voodoo and related practices like Hoodoo, meet the powerful loas (spirits) central to its practice, and understand the religion's vital role in resistance movements like the Haitian Revolution. Delve into detailed descriptions of rituals, sacred spaces, and festivals that keep the faith alive today. With insights into scientific studies, anthropological research, and the portrayal of Voodoo in popular culture, History of Voodoo provides a comprehensive, respectful, and clear understanding of this enduring tradition.
